Transaction 270279c53cb40742e5bf2afafcb5417ee88890601152a397d776be3687d85699
1 Input
1 Output
-
270279c53cb40742e5bf2afafcb5417ee88890601152a397d776be3687d85699:0
- value
- 702380
- script pubkey
- OP_0 OP_PUSHBYTES_32 1cb77c6c30581d495193e0c5d59389e01d5655e332b15cf521cb37bd5ed58744
- address
- bc1qrjmhcmpstqw5j5vnurzatyufuqw4v40rx2c4eafpevmm6hk4sazqsuerfd